TORONTO - Alternative lender Goeasy Ltd. says it categorically denies and refutes the findings of a short-seller report that suggested the company is under-reporting credit losses.

The Mississauga, Ont.-based company behind the easyfinancial brand says in a news release that it remains confident in both the quality of its consumer loan portfolio and the sustainability of its business.
